PVE9升级后遗症 - IGPU/sriov/SR-IOV无法使用
pve升级9 sr-iov GG了
参考前一篇文章PVE8升级到PVE9-XQLEE'Blog正常升级后,重启开机pve发现igpu拆分无法识别了。

资源映射全红,使用了igpu的虚拟机无法开机。
解决办法
查看igpu的模块信息
dkms status
查看信息发现只有6.8.header的模块,没有最新的6.14.x的头模块
安装最新头模块
查看当前系统内核版本
uname -a
安装与系统内核版本一致的headers模块
apt install proxmox-headers-6.14.8-2-pve
重装sriov-dkms
下载软件
wget -O /tmp/i915-sriov-dkms_2025.07.22_amd64.deb "https://github.com/strongtz/i915-sriov-dkms/releases/download/2025.07.22/i915-sriov-dkms_2025.07.22_amd64.deb"
安装
dpkg -i /tmp/i915-sriov-dkms_2025.07.22_amd64.deb
查看
root@pve:~# dkms status
i915-sriov-dkms/2025.07.22, 6.14.8-2-pve, x86_64: installed (Original modules exist)
i915-sriov-dkms/2025.07.22, 6.8.12-13-pve, x86_64: installed (Original modules exist)
root@pve:~#
重启pve
启动后再次查看igpu全部绿了,虚拟机也可以正常启动了
https://www.syntaxspace.com/article/pve9-sr-iov.html
评论